MaroonRebel Posted October 25, 2020 Report Share Posted October 25, 2020 I think if he chooses PU, it is because he thinks they develop big men. I don't see it. PU's bigs are good college players, but have yet to make the jump to the next level. Haas and Hammons are in the G-league. Haas was not even drafted. PU's bigs play with their back to the basket and the NBA has moved away from that style. During the Edward years he had a green light which opened up the paint. However, most years have been completely different. Swanigan was highly touted before going to PU and most talked one and done. After two years he left PU for a late first round pick and a fading NBA career. If you ask if Painter is a good coach I say,"yes". Does he develop players into his system. Yes, he does. Does he develop players for good NBA careers? No, not really. If the young man chooses PU then that is his choice and I wish him the best.
